Output 80e5e1144551434b8d42d6eed745c690201d5b6516bc3d3b627ea43c3fc5c6a7:0

value
15929145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d26349be9f1db7630530663d3e6aeb28d74a66 OP_EQUAL
address
3C4rKDxg976pFDiu9jbwAgserYrtfanmSx
transaction
80e5e1144551434b8d42d6eed745c690201d5b6516bc3d3b627ea43c3fc5c6a7
confirmations
348061
spent
true